§ 7-114 — Industrial uses; volunteer or paid donor

Illinois·Topic REGULATION·Ch. 210 HEALTH FACILITIES AND REGULATION·Act 210 ILCS 25/ Illinois Clinical Laboratory and Blood Bank Act.·Art. Article VII - Acceptance, Collection, Identification And Examination Of Specimens, And Reports Of Findings
Blood and blood components, including salvage plasma, may be used and transferred for industrial uses without regard to whether its original acquisition was from a volunteer donor or a paid donor.
